Forensic Evidence: From Crime Scene to Courtroom
The rigorous work of forensic scientists plays a vital role in criminal investigations. At the location of a crime, investigators carefully collect physical traces, such here as fingerprints, that can corroborate or contradict witness testimony.
These samples of evidence are then moved to a laboratory where they undergo thorough analysis. Forensic experts harness specialized tools to scrutinize the substance, uncovering valuable clues that can help decipher a case.
Ultimately, the forensic evidence is presented in court, where it functions as corroboration for claims. Jurors carefully evaluate the evidence presented to them, deciding the outcome of a trial.
